Output e3baab5d8d827db20ff949926e8c167b31fa59a836e751c0d48f9d02e00c0fdf:35

value
366000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c7eae6cf3dc4cc8e845302bb86c6d7f065c483e OP_EQUAL
address
3Qi5xrohPU7zdxeCk6JGJAUdFqWHnuKEFF
transaction
e3baab5d8d827db20ff949926e8c167b31fa59a836e751c0d48f9d02e00c0fdf
spent
true